Learning outcomes

The aim of the course is to provide students with basic principles and
institutions of employment law and social security law. The course aims also
to help the student gain tools for legal reasoning and an appropriate use of
employment law vocabulary. During lectures it will be privileged a close
link between legal discipline and its pratical application, with particular
reference to judicial statements, as well as to an active participation by
students.

Syllabus

The program includes the following topics:
- sources of labor law;
- subordination and self-employment;
- the constitution of the employment relationship and the employment contracts;
- the employment relationship: powers, rights and obligations of the parties;
- suspension of employment relationship;
- termination of employment relationship;
- protection of workers' rights;
- the social security legal system.
